The Importance Of Proper Window Cleaning Training

Window cleaning is an essential task for both residential and commercial properties. Clean windows can enhance the overall appearance of a building, improve natural light intake, and promote a positive image for customers and residents. However, window cleaning is not as simple as it may seem. It requires specific skills, techniques, and safety measures to ensure a job well done. This is why window cleaning training is crucial for anyone looking to enter this profession.

window cleaning training provides individuals with the necessary knowledge and skills to effectively clean windows in a safe and efficient manner. Proper training covers everything from the different types of windows and glass surfaces to the tools, equipment, and cleaning solutions needed for the job. Training also includes important safety procedures to prevent accidents and injuries while working at heights.

One of the key benefits of window cleaning training is the opportunity to learn proper techniques for achieving streak-free and spotless results. Training programs teach individuals how to use squeegees, scrapers, microfiber cloths, and other tools to remove dirt, grime, and water stains from windows without leaving any marks behind. Understanding the right cleaning solutions and methods for specific types of glass is essential for achieving professional results that will satisfy customers.

Another important aspect of window cleaning training is learning how to work safely at heights. Window cleaners often have to work on ladders, scaffolding, or other elevated platforms to reach windows on high-rise buildings. Proper training teaches individuals how to set up and secure their equipment, how to use safety harnesses and ropes, and how to navigate around potential hazards to prevent falls and injuries. By following safety protocols, window cleaners can protect themselves and others while performing their tasks.

In addition to technical skills and safety measures, window cleaning training also covers customer service and business management aspects of the profession. Window cleaners need to communicate effectively with clients, provide estimates and invoices, and maintain professional relationships to build a loyal customer base. Training programs often include modules on customer service, time management, and marketing strategies to help individuals succeed in their window cleaning businesses.

Furthermore, window cleaning training can lead to certification or qualification that distinguishes individuals as skilled professionals in the industry. Some training programs offer certification exams or assessments to test a cleaner’s knowledge, skills, and abilities. By obtaining a certification, window cleaners can demonstrate their expertise and commitment to high standards of quality and safety to potential clients and employers.
